Summary/Abstract: The field of aesthetic medicine is a trend in modern medicine and nowadays patients not only want to be healthy, they also want to enjoy life, be fit and minimize the effects of physiological aging. Societal acceptance of aesthetic procedures is increasing and desire to improve the external appearance may be related to the extensive media coverage which basically increases the considered benefits. Young patients should understand that results of surgical aesthetical procedures may lead to permanent change. A complete assessment of reason why the young patient wishes to have the procedure, and what difference the patient thinks it will make to his/her life, should be undertaken. Poor psychological outcomes are possible and unrealistic expectations may should warn the doctor against procedure until the patient is emotionally mature and may need a psychological referral in order to maintain the psychosocial health and improve the quality of life.
